https://gcc.gnu.org/bugzilla/show_bug.cgi?id=121416
--- Comment #2 from Andrew Stubbs <ams at gcc dot gnu.org> --- Let's look at why the atomic instructions that exist aren't working for us, before we try to use the big dumb hammer fix (and does that solution *really* work, if we don't understand the cache architecture properly?)